題名:女子足球選手在不同場地規格比賽內容變化之研究

本研究的目的針對女子足球選手在不同場地規格中身體活動量之影響進行分析比較。以大學女子足球 17名選手為研究對象,平均身高 163.6公分,體重 54.9公斤,年齡 19.9歲,球齡 9.9年。分析選手在 2v2、3v3、4v4、5v5不同場地規格小型比賽中,選手的運動強度、移動距離與觸球數。以單因子重覆量數“變異數”分析、獨立樣本 t考驗等統計方法進行分析。所得結果顯示如下:一、4v4的比賽中心跳率昀大、 2v2昀低,出現顯著差異。二、5v5的移動距離約為 91m/min,明顯少於其它場地規格,達到顯著差異。三、2v2、3v3、4v4的觸球數均多於 5v5的比賽,達到顯著差異。四、不同運動能力的選手在運動強度、移動距離與觸球數方面相比較的結果,雖然未出現顯著差異。但是在觸球數方面:國家隊選手均多於非國家隊選手,表示運動能力較高的選手在移動的品質上能對球做出更有效的技術與戰術上的運用。
The purpose of this research was to compare and analyse the women soccer players physical activity under different small sided game.The women soccer team has 17 players; the average height is 163.6 cm, body weight is 54.9kg, age is19.9years old, and the number of years engaging in soccer game is 9.9years. Competitors are in different field standards, which are 2v2, 3v3, 4v4 and 5v5. Small sided game are preformed, which allow to analyze the players’ physical activity intensity, the distance in movement and the number of times contacting the ball. By using the One way ANOVA, independent sample t tests and statistical methods will help to carry on the comparison. In addition, results have shown that the woman soccer players playing under different fields in 2v2 small competition has the lowest heart rate, in fact, when in 3v3 and 4v4, the heart rate is close to that in the official game . In field 5v5, the movement distance is 91.2m/min, which is less than other field standards. On the other hand, the numbers of time contacting the ball in 2v2, 3v3, 4v4 are more than in 5v5, which means the chances of contacting the ball will decrease when number of players increase. In conclusion, different types of sport players seem to not have much difference in their body activity intensities, distances in movement and the number of times contacting the ball. However, players in the national team have better techniques in handling the balls and have higher chances of contacting with the ball as to players not in the national team.
